
A systemic model for how the next generation lives

Young people don't reject housing; they reject outdated living systems. Their lives are defined by transitions, fluid identity, and cognitive load — not permanence.
The challenge isn't a lack of housing. It's that traditional housing was designed for linear life trajectories that no longer exist. Today's generation experiences life as a series of evolving phases, each requiring different environmental support, flexibility, and psychological alignment.
What's needed isn't more buildings. It's intelligent systems that respond to how people actually live now: fluidly, intentionally, and in constant adaptation.

Housing was built for linear lives; people now live in phases. The assumption of permanence embedded in traditional housing design is fundamentally misaligned with contemporary life patterns.
My background in global hospitality and experience design revealed the same patterns across cultures and contexts. People seek environments that understand their current life phase, not just shelter.
The principles of Experience Architecture now apply directly to living. What worked in hospitality — understanding transitions, designing for emotional states, creating adaptive systems — is precisely what housing needs.

Housing fails when it focuses on static structures rather than dynamic systems. This framework reconceptualises living environments as layered, interconnected systems that support human adaptation and growth.

Before conscious thought occurs, the body is already assessing its environment. The Sensation Layer addresses the immediate, pre-cognitive responses that determine whether a space feels safe, comfortable, and conducive to well-being.
This isn't about luxury or aesthetics. It's about neurological regulation. When sensory inputs are calibrated correctly, cognitive load decreases dramatically, freeing mental resources for what matters: living, working, connecting, creating.
Natural circadian alignment and task-appropriate illumination
Sound absorption that creates calm without isolation
Temperature and airflow that support sustained presence
Surfaces that communicate quality and care through touch
Legible layouts that reduce decision fatigue
Designated areas for nervous system reset

Every life phase requires different environmental support. A space that enabled focus during intense career building may need to shift towards rest and reflection during recovery. The Purpose Layer ensures living environments actively support whatever phase a person is navigating.
This layer rejects the notion of one-size-fits-all housing. Instead, it asks: what does this person need to become right now? The environment should answer that question clearly.
When needed: grounding, predictability, and consistent anchoring during uncertain transitions
Space for self-expression, experimentation, and becoming without judgment or constraint
Independence that doesn't require disconnection from community or support networks
Environments that reflect and support current emotional needs rather than working against them
True restoration, not just rest — spaces designed for deep recovery and sustained vitality
Equal capacity to enable peak performance or provide sanctuary during difficult periods
Key principle: Design for alignment, not permanence

Life doesn't happen in static moments. It unfolds across time, through daily rhythms, weekly patterns, seasonal shifts, and life transitions. The Rhythm Layer designs for this temporal dimension, recognising that how people move through time in space is as important as the space itself.
Traditional housing ignores tempo entirely. Rooms are simply rooms. But human experience is fundamentally temporal — we need spaces that support acceleration when required and deceleration when necessary.
Intentional transitions from outside chaos to internal calm
Spaces designed to actively slow nervous system activation
Quick recovery areas for between-task regulation
Circulation that supports state changes, not just movement
Environmental responsiveness to natural temporal cycles
Support for both intense focus and unhurried presence
You're designing tempo, not rooms.

The first three layers create experience. This layer ensures that experience can evolve. The System Layer is the operational architecture that enables a living environment to adapt as life changes — without friction, without penalty, without forcing people into rigid structures that no longer serve them.
Flexible rental structures that accommodate phase transitions without forcing displacement or long-term commitments that no longer align
Physical environments that can be reconfigured for different uses, privacy needs, or co-living arrangements as circumstances evolve
Gradated control over visibility, accessibility, and social interaction — from complete solitude to full community engagement
Infrastructure that remains functional through disruption, whether personal crisis or external events
Systems that enable reinvention without requiring complete upheaval of living situation or support structures
Technology interfaces that reduce rather than increase cognitive load, providing transparency without overwhelm

When sensation is calibrated correctly, purpose becomes clearer. When purpose aligns with life phase, rhythm naturally emerges. When rhythm is supported by adaptive systems, evolution becomes possible rather than disruptive.
This is the fundamental shift from housing-as-product to housing-as-system. The former asks: what features does this building have? The latter asks: how does this environment enable the life being lived within it?

Implementing Phase-Based Living Architecture requires fundamentally rethinking how we conceive, design, and operate residential environments. The implications extend far beyond architecture into policy, business models, and community structure.
Design decisions must prioritise nervous system regulation, emotional alignment, and cognitive clarity over aesthetic preferences or conventional layouts. The question shifts from "what does this look like?" to "how does this make people feel and function?"
Forced sociality creates pressure, not connection. Authentic community forms when people have agency over their level of engagement. Design should enable diverse modes of interaction without mandating any particular one.
People shouldn't have to move every time their life changes. Living environments should accommodate phase transitions through flexible systems, modular arrangements, and adaptive infrastructure that evolves alongside residents.
A gym and a rooftop terrace don't create great living. Intelligent operational systems, responsive infrastructure, and thoughtful experience design do. The focus must shift from feature lists to systemic coherence.
